Subject: Quick update on Project Larkspur

Hi all,

Heads-up for the finance team: Larkspur, our billing consolidation project, has slipped another six weeks. The Renvick integration turned out messier than scoped, and we've had to pull two engineers off to patch it. Revised go-live is now mid-Q3, which means the old reconciliation process stays in place a bit longer — sorry. Budget impact is modest but real; details in the attached sheet. One more thing you should know first.

board note of kagep-yahig: Only 9 of the 120 pilot accounts renewed Quenix, so a churn review is set for April 1.

# Break-Glass: Catalog Cache Invalidation

Scope: the Pinrow product catalog at Veldstone Retail. If stale prices persist after a purge and the Hollowmere invalidation queue is wedged, use break-glass to flush the edge tier directly. Contractors: get verbal sign-off from the catalog lead first. Steps: open the Hollowmere admin shell, select emergency-flush, confirm the tenant, and run it once — repeated flushes thrash the origin. Access is logged and expires after 20 minutes. Unseal the admin shell with the passphrase below.

recovery phrase for kahop-tajog: istix-casvan

Management Meeting Minutes — Warranty-Cost Overrun

Attendees: all department heads.

Warranty costs on the Veldane 300 series ran 31% over forecast this quarter. Root cause: gasket failures traced to the Morrick supplier batch. Actions: engineering to validate replacement supplier by month-end; service to triage open claims; finance to restate the reserve. Customer comms on hold pending legal review. Next checkpoint in two weeks. Leadership added the following note for planning:

management briefing: Only 5 of the 80 pilot accounts renewed Zorix, so a churn review is set for October 1.

**Guest Wi-Fi Desk — Reception Procedures (Harlowe House)**

The guest Wi-Fi desk sits to the left of the main reception counter and must be staffed whenever visitors are expected. Issue each guest a printed voucher, record their host's name in the day log, and remind them vouchers expire at 18:00. To restock voucher paper, use the supplies cupboard behind the desk, which is secured with the code shown below.

badge for fafop-fajof: bdg-Z-47